The ingredients needed to make Persimmon Mixed with Sake Lees and Miso:
  1. Prepare Persimmon
  2. Take ◎Sake lees
  3. Get ◎Miso
  4. Take ◎Sugar
  5. Make ready ◎Salt
  6. Take ◎Soy sauce

Steps to make Persimmon Mixed with Sake Lees and Miso:
  1. Combine the ◎ ingredients.
  2. Use a fork or spoon to knead it well. It should come out like this. Place in a bowl.
  3. Peel the persimmon and cut into 1 cm chunks like this.
  4. Add the cut persimmon to the bowl with the kneaded ◎ ingredients and mix well. You can do this step with your hands.
  5. Once the persimmon is well-coated with the ◎ mixture, transfer to dishes and serve.
